Key Metrics
- Price-to-Earnings Ratio (P/E Ratio): This compares the company's stock price to its earnings per share. It's a good way to gauge whether the stock is overvalued or undervalued relative to its peers.
- Earnings Per Share (EPS): This measures the company's profit per share of outstanding stock. It's a key indicator of profitability and growth potential.
- Dividend Yield: If iiipseiryceyse pays dividends, this tells you the percentage of the stock price that you'll receive in dividends each year. It's an important consideration for income-seeking investors.
- Return on Equity (ROE): This measures how efficiently the company is using shareholder equity to generate profits. A higher ROE indicates better performance.
- Debt-to-Equity Ratio: This measures the company's debt relative to its equity. A high ratio could indicate financial risk.
Technical Analysis Tools
- Stock Charts: These provide a visual representation of the stock's price movements over time. Look for patterns and trends that could signal future price movements.
- Moving Averages: These smooth out the stock's price data to help you identify trends. Common moving averages include the 50-day and 200-day moving averages.
- Relative Strength Index (RSI): This measures the magnitude of recent price changes to evaluate overbought or oversold conditions in the stock.
- Volume: This tells you how many shares of the stock are being traded. High volume can indicate strong interest in the stock.
